3. Private vs. Company
Sponsored
There are two different types
of truck driving schools you
can choose from: private, or
company sponsored.
Company sponsored schools
often require little to no money
upfront and tuition payments can
sometimes be taken directly out
of your check once you’re hired.
Private schools often require
tuition up front, but can still
provide high quality training and
can help with job placement.
4. What You Need to
Know Before Applying
Before applying to a school in order to get a
truck driving job, make sure you check out a
few different schools and see what they have
to offer.
Ask about tuition, driving time, and what job
opportunities the training will enable you to
apply for.
An important question to ask is “how much
driving time will I actually have?”
5. What Separates Good
Schools From the Mediocre
Good schools will typically offer
three things:
• Job Placement
• Quality Instructors
• Quality Training
You can know a school offers
these things by visiting them
and asking questions.
6. What Separates Good
Schools From the Mediocre Cont’d
Quality schools should have several different
driving yards, but also have enough instructors
to properly monitor all of them.
Don’t assume a school will automatically help
with job placement. Ask what services they have
and what options are available after graduation.
Lastly, a quality school will have instructors who
are knowledgeable about the industry and
provide superior information and employ
effective teaching strategies.
7. How Is a Recruiter
Useful to You?
Recruiters are people who try to
get you to join their schools.
They can be useful, but they’re
also salespeople.
If you ask the right questions, a
recruiter can help you figure out if a
school is right for you.
If they don’t answer your prepared
questions or don’t seem to know
much about the school or how it
operates, they’re probably just
looking to make a commission.
